In perl.git, the branch zefram/gvsv_empty has been created
<http://perl5.git.perl.org/perl.git/commitdiff/b66f10a9ff2efe82ee9c8d887dde53d78dc8fb5c?hp=0000000000000000000000000000000000000000>
at b66f10a9ff2efe82ee9c8d887dde53d78dc8fb5c (commit)
- Log -----------------------------------------------------------------
commit b66f10a9ff2efe82ee9c8d887dde53d78dc8fb5c
Author: Zefram <[email protected]>
Date: Tue Apr 13 23:42:50 2010 +0100
[perl #73666] *foo{SCALAR} should not autovivify
M pp.c
M t/op/gv.t
commit caa4d6036ab10ec9a46e2c4b2ff685aa58eb4fb5
Author: Zefram <[email protected]>
Date: Tue Apr 13 23:07:18 2010 +0100
make PERL_DONT_CREATE_GVSV mandatory
It's now clear that this option doesn't break anything. It's semantically
superior to automatic creation of GvSVs. There's no longer any need
for it to be optional.
M embed.fnc
M embed.h
M gv.c
M gv.h
M makedef.pl
M mathoms.c
M perl.c
M perl.h
M proto.h
M scope.c
M sv.c
-----------------------------------------------------------------------
--
Perl5 Master Repository